How to fill out code of conduct for

Illustration

How to fill out code of conduct for

01
Read the guidelines and regulations of your organization.
02
Identify the key values and principles to be included in the code of conduct.
03
Outline the expected behaviors and policies concerning professional conduct.
04
Specify the consequences for violating the code of conduct.
05
Involve stakeholders in the drafting process for comprehensive input.
06
Review the document for clarity, comprehensive coverage, and alignment with organizational values.
07
Seek legal advice if necessary to ensure compliance with laws and regulations.
08
Publish the code of conduct and communicate its importance to all members.
09
Provide training or resources for employees to understand the code.

A code of conduct is a set of guidelines and principles designed to outline the acceptable behaviors and expectations for individuals within an organization.
Typically, all employees, management, and sometimes board members are required to file a code of conduct within an organization.
To fill out a code of conduct, individuals should carefully read the guidelines, acknowledge their understanding and agreement, and submit any required disclosures or affirmations as specified by the organization.
The purpose of a code of conduct is to promote ethical behavior, ensure compliance with laws and regulations, and establish a positive work environment.
Information that must be reported often includes conflicts of interest, adherence to policies, breaches of conduct, and any other relevant ethical considerations.
